## Flag rollouts with Switchyard

Switchyard is our feature-flag rollout framework. Flags are defined in the `flags/` directory and evaluated per-tenant with percentage ramps. Stale flags older than 90 days trigger a cleanup ticket automatically. When modifying ramp logic, update the simulation fixtures too, or the canary check will block deploys. Flag ownership questions and cleanup disputes should be directed to the address below.

pager mailbox: druwyn@norvaio.corp

Account Recovery — Pagewright Static Builds

If a customer loses access to their Pagewright dashboard, incremental rebuilds of their static site will continue from the last known-good deploy, so no content is lost during recovery. Confirm the customer's last rebuild timestamp in the Orlin console, then initiate the recovery flow from the admin panel. Do not trigger a full rebuild until access is restored. Unlocking the recovery flow requires the passphrase below.

recovery phrase for yadup-taguf: wenael-quenox-kelix

/*
 * Rollout threshold for the Glimmerlatch flag framework.
 * Plugin authors: do not override this constant directly.
 * Glimmerlatch evaluates flags in cohort order, and this value
 * caps the percentage of traffic any single plugin can shift
 * per evaluation window. Changing it requires sign-off from the
 * Fenwick platform team. When filing a support request, include
 * the framework build token, which is emitted on the next line.
 */

session token of tajog-fahaf = htk21_4ae55819f45410afcb307

MEMO — Sales Leads Only

Effective next quarter, Varnell Systems will outsource tier-one customer support to Quillbrook Services, operating from their Dunmere facility. In-house agents move to tier-two escalation only. Expect handover friction for six weeks; flag complaints directly to Marta Hollis. Pricing scripts and refund thresholds remain unchanged. Do not discuss the transition with clients until the announcement clears legal review. Further direction follows below.

board note of kageg-bahof: The renewal with Holwynax Holdings closes at $2 million a year, 5 percent below the last contract. Project Ulaath slips by two quarters because of the supplier delay.